TRAP-6 (PAR-1 agonist peptide), a peptide fragment, is a selective protease activating receptor 1 (PAR1) agonist. TRAP-6 activates human platelets via the thrombin receptor. TRAP-6 shows no activity at PAR4[1].
TRAP-6 (0.01-10 μM) triggers calcium mobilization in Xenopus oocytes heterologously expressing PAR1[1].
TRAP-6 (0.01-10 μM; 30 min) activates human platelets[1].
TRAP-6 (100 μM) does not cause the platelets of rabbits or rats to change shape, aggregate, release granule contents, or form thromboxane[2].
TRAP (1 mg/kg; i.v.) produces a biphasic response in blood pressure in inactin-anesthetized rats[3].
